Показать сообщение отдельно
  #9  
Старый 05.09.2012, 19:52
Аватар для YVitaliy
YVitaliy YVitaliy вне форума
Местный
 
Регистрация: 14.12.2011
Сообщения: 481
Версия Delphi: Borland Delphi7
Репутация: 17
По умолчанию

Если использовать TAction's то можно так сделать:
Код:
procedure TForm1.FormCreate(Sender: TObject);
begin
 combobox1.Clear;
 combobox1.AddItem('Action0',ActionManager1.Actions[0]);
 combobox1.AddItem('Action1',ActionManager1.Actions[1]);
.............................................................
end;
.............................................................
procedure TForm1.ComboBox1Click(Sender: TObject);
begin
 (combobox1.Items.Objects[combobox1.ItemIndex] as TAction).Execute;
end;
Ну, или вроде того.
Ответить с цитированием